Dream scores franchise-record 113 points, beating Fever for second time in 3 days; Angel Reese reaches 1,000 rebounds

The Atlanta Dream set a franchise scoring record in back-to-back wins over the Indiana Fever as Angel Reese hits a historic rebounding milestone.

The brief

The Atlanta Dream defeated the Indiana Fever with a franchise-record 113 points, marking their second victory against the team in three days. During the same period, Angel Reese surpassed 1,000 career rebounds.

Coverage from outlets including USA Today, ESPN, and The New York Times highlights Reese’s status as the fastest player in WNBA history to reach the 1,000-rebound milestone. Observers are tracking the ongoing performance of the Atlanta Dream following consecutive 100-point games.

Quick answers

What record did the Atlanta Dream set?

The team scored a franchise-record 113 points in a single game against the Indiana Fever.

What milestone did Angel Reese achieve?

Angel Reese reached 1,000 career rebounds, becoming the fastest player in WNBA history to do so.

How often have the Dream played the Fever recently?

The Atlanta Dream defeated the Indiana Fever twice within a three-day span.
